Некоторые преимущества совместного ревьюирования кода (код-ревью):
Раннее обнаружение ошибок. www.cloud4y.ru Вместо исправления ошибок в готовом продукте, их устраняют ещё в процессе написания. www.cloud4y.ru
Соблюдение стандартов качества и стиля кода. rb.ru Это особенно важно для долгосрочных проектов: единообразный код легче поддерживать, улучшать и передавать новым участникам команды. rb.ru
Улучшение архитектуры и дизайна кода. rb.ru Рецензенты могут предложить более эффективные или элегантные способы реализации функциональности. rb.ru
Снижение технического долга. rb.ru Технический долг возникает, когда разработчики принимают быстрые решения в ущерб качеству кода. rb.ru Код-ревью помогает минимизировать технический долг. rb.ru
Обучение для всех участников процесса. rb.ru Молодые разработчики получают ценные рекомендации по улучшению качества своего кода. rb.ru Более опытные разработчики развивают навыки анализа чужого кода, улучшают свои коммуникативные способности и получают новый взгляд на привычные задачи. rb.ru
Создание культуры сотрудничества внутри команды. rb.ru Когда разработчики регулярно проверяют код друг друга, это укрепляет доверие и улучшает коммуникацию. rb.ru Участники начинают лучше понимать подходы своих коллег к решению задач, что снижает вероятность конфликтов или недопонимания. rb.ru
Повышение безопасности ПО. www.cloud4y.ru Чем больше внимания уделяется качеству кода на этапе разработки, тем меньше вероятность возникновения критических проблем после релиза. rb.ru
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.